As an industry leader in applying robot automation in manufacturing environments, AMT is a wellspring of engineering talent.
Since 1989, Applied Manufacturing Technologies has become an industry leader in robot automation engineering and robotics in manufacturing with a global presence. Over 120 experienced and highly trained robot automation engineers with over 1,250 combined years of experience are engaged in robot automation projects across an array of industries. We have engineered over 25,000 robot automation systems worldwide on 5,000 projects for over 600 customers. We manage a wide range of projects including:
Pre-engineering consulting and cost analysis
Strategic planning and advanced manufacturing engineering
Simulation of robotic operations and complete system throughput, system layout and mechanical design
Control system design
Robot automation programming and software development
Risk assessment and safety consulting
Comprehensive management of field start-up operations
History
Established in 1989.
AMT has grown from just a few individuals focused on the automotive market in 1989 to more than 120 technical professionals who execute robotics automation services across a diversity of industries. We’re in aerospace, alternative energy, food and beverage, rubber and plastics, material handling and pretty much anywhere robots are used.

As founder and President of Applied Manufacturing Technologies, Mike is laser focused on the company’s leadership position in the world of robotic automation. He founded the company in 1989 after a successful and diverse career with GMF, now Fanuc Robotics, where he was responsible for product marketing, the planning and development of offline robot programming and simulation software. Prior to entering the robot industry, Mike held engineering and R&D positions with Westinghouse Corporation and Eaton Corporation.
Mike holds a BS in Electrical Engineering from Michigan State University and a MS in Electric & Computer Engineering from Wayne State University. He is also a licensed Professional Engineer.
